NR Daily: As Russia Falters, Ukraine Prepares to Seize the Initiative
Reviewed by Diogenes
on
May 03, 2023
Rating:
The latest political news from NewsNation View online. The latest analysis and political reporting--from Washington to your local legislat...
No comments: